本文目录导读:
非关系型数据库(NoSQL)作为一种新兴的数据库技术,因其灵活性和可扩展性,已经在各个领域得到了广泛应用,本文将详细介绍非关系型数据库在各类信息系统中的应用类型,帮助读者更好地理解这一技术。
分布式存储系统
分布式存储系统是非关系型数据库的重要应用之一,这类系统通过将数据分散存储在多个节点上,实现了高可用性和高并发访问,以下是几种典型的分布式存储系统:
图片来源于网络,如有侵权联系删除
1、分布式文件系统:如Hadoop的HDFS,适用于大规模数据存储和处理。
2、分布式数据库:如MongoDB、Cassandra等,具有分布式存储、高可用性和可扩展性等特点。
3、分布式缓存:如Redis、Memcached等,用于提高系统性能,减少数据库访问压力。
社交网络平台
社交网络平台是非关系型数据库的另一个重要应用领域,这类平台需要处理大量用户数据,包括用户关系、动态、评论等,以下是几种基于非关系型数据库的社交网络平台:
1、微博:采用MongoDB存储用户数据,包括微博内容、评论、转发等。
2、QQ空间:使用MongoDB存储用户动态、相册、留言等数据。
3、Facebook:早期使用Cassandra存储用户数据,近年来转向了Apache Cassandra。
图片来源于网络,如有侵权联系删除
物联网(IoT)平台
物联网平台是非关系型数据库在工业、家居等领域的应用之一,这类平台需要处理大量实时数据,包括设备状态、传感器数据等,以下是几种基于非关系型数据库的物联网平台:
1、物联网平台设备管理:如AWS IoT Core、阿里云物联网平台等,使用非关系型数据库存储设备信息、状态等。
2、工业物联网平台:如MindSphere、Predix等,采用非关系型数据库存储设备数据、生产数据等。
电子商务平台
电子商务平台是非关系型数据库在商业领域的应用之一,这类平台需要处理大量商品信息、用户数据、订单数据等,以下是几种基于非关系型数据库的电子商务平台:
1、淘宝网:使用MongoDB存储商品信息、用户数据、订单数据等。
2、京东:采用MongoDB存储商品信息、用户数据、订单数据等。
3、亚马逊:使用Cassandra存储商品信息、用户数据、订单数据等。
图片来源于网络,如有侵权联系删除
大数据分析平台
大数据分析平台是非关系型数据库在数据分析领域的应用之一,这类平台需要处理大量结构化和非结构化数据,包括日志数据、传感器数据等,以下是几种基于非关系型数据库的大数据分析平台:
1、Hadoop生态圈:如Hive、Spark等,使用HDFS存储数据,Cassandra、MongoDB等非关系型数据库进行数据存储和分析。
2、京东数云:采用Hadoop生态圈和MongoDB、Cassandra等非关系型数据库进行数据分析。
非关系型数据库在各个领域得到了广泛应用,为各类信息系统提供了高性能、高可用性和可扩展性的解决方案,随着技术的不断发展,非关系型数据库将在更多领域发挥重要作用,了解非关系型数据库在各类信息系统中的应用,有助于我们更好地利用这一技术,推动信息系统的发展。
标签: #非关系型数据库都有哪些信息系统类型
评论列表